Another factor to consider when choosing the best cat flap cover is the seal it provides. A poorly sealed door can allow cold air to enter your home and make it uncomfortable for your cat. It is important to choose an option that has a tight seal even when the flaps aren't open.

Some manufacturers have tried to alleviate the issue by incorporating what they call"draught-excluders" on the frames of their cat doors. These draught excluders are a brush-like material intended to insulate the flap and stop cold air from entering. It can be ineffective and it is difficult to put in.

You should select a cat flap with an incredibly thick flap as well as an check here extra flap for insulation. This will block out a significant amount of cold air and will aid in reducing your energy costs.

Insulation

The best cat flaps for winter are lined with insulation, which helps keep cold air out and warm air in. A single flap will do this if it's padded and thick, but dual doors can also help as they create many tiny air pockets that slow the circulation of cold air into and out of your home. The frame of the door should be insulated as well. Solid doors made of wood are a good choice as they offer insulation click here and are strong enough to stand up to freezing temperatures.

The insulation capabilities of your cat flap cover are crucial as you'll want to keep the cold as far as you can, thereby reducing heating costs and ensuring your family is at ease. It is crucial to ensure that the flap is sealed tightly when it's not in use, as a gap read more which allows cold air to be able to enter your home won't aid in keeping your home warm. Manufacturers have tried to minimize the issue using draught excluders. These are brushes that are put around the flap of the cat when it's not being used.
